Hey I'm glad you guys like our exhaust. The looooong R&D process is how we end up with such a great sounding exhaust, especially when you consider that there are our Berk HFC's installed in these vids as well.

About the dyno's performed. The whole exhaust works in concert with each other and there is only so much power you can extract out of the exhaust system before you approach 100% efficiency. So lets arbitrarily say that the 370Z's complete exhaust (header/HFC/exhaust) has a potential of 30hp. If you bolt on a set of our Berk HFC's most of you are dynoing in the 15-17hp range (and some of you 19hp ). So you've opened up the bottleneck at the OEM cats and you have a much more free flowing exhaust. So then you install our exhaust and net 14hp.

If you did the test in reverse you would see 20hp+ from the Berk exhaust then 10hp from the cats.

The dyno tests on our exhaust have shown to make 14hp ON TOP OF our HFC's. What we have here is a real performer that isn't diluted down when you make improvements upstream of the catback exhaust system.

All of our exhausts include the resonated midpipes at no additional charge. Our exhaust is priced at an MSRP of $1199.99 and like new cars dealers set actual pricing on the exhaust.
